Ministers Rebuild Key Boards: FSC & Others Reorganized, 5 Appointments

On Friday, June 20, the Council of Ministers held a meeting at the Trésor Building in Port-Louis. During the session, several key decisions were made. Notably, the board of the Financial Services Commission (FSC) was restructured. The appointment of a new Chief Executive for the FSC is still pending.
The councils for traditional medicine and pharmacy were also reformed.
Parmanand Mawah, Permanent Secretary, was appointed as part-time chairman of the Traditional Medicine Board.
Rajesh Unnuth was named part-time chairman of the Mental Health Commission.
Additionally, Ka Yee Leung Tak Wan now serves as part-time chairwoman of the Taxi Operators Welfare Fund, and Ham Sharma Kowlessur was appointed part-time chairman of the Road Transport Advisory Board.
